The 26th was the best of the last 3 days. Highlights lately include the first Surf Scoter and Lincoln’s Sparrow of the season on the 25th, the highest duck count of the season so far on the 26th, and the first Horned Grebes of the season today.
968 ducks were counted on the 26th, however due to their distance plus the passing rain decreasing light and visibility, only 324 were i.d.’d to species. Of those, 250 were Redhead. Also of note was a Surf Scoter & 9 White-winged Scoters.
